What Happens When You Put a Regular TV Outside

Indoor TVs aren't designed for outdoor air. That sounds obvious, but the failure mode is more subtle than most people expect — it's rarely a single rainstorm that kills the TV. It's accumulated environmental stress that builds quietly over weeks or months:

  • Humidity and condensation. Outdoor air carries moisture even when it isn't raining. Morning dew and overnight temperature drops cause condensation to form inside the TV housing — on circuit boards, connectors, and backlighting components. This moisture doesn't need to be visible to cause damage. Corrosion builds gradually until something fails.
  • Heat buildup. Outdoor environments have less controlled airflow than living rooms. A TV mounted against a wall in direct or reflected sun builds up internal heat that the cooling design wasn't built to handle. Electronics fail faster under sustained heat stress.
  • Wind-driven moisture. Many people install an indoor TV under a covered roof and assume it's protected. Wind pushes rain sideways and upward — into ports, cable openings, and seams that are left unsealed on indoor TVs.
  • Dust, pollen, and insects. Indoor TVs have open vents for airflow. Outdoors, those same vents pull in pollen, fine dust, and sometimes insects. Debris accumulates inside, blocks cooling, and eventually causes overheating or short circuits.
  • UV degradation. Sunlight breaks down the plastic housing, adhesives, and coatings on indoor TVs — components not designed for UV exposure. Over time, seals become brittle and the housing cracks, accelerating moisture ingress.

The Scenarios Where It Sometimes Works (And the Conditions Required)

There are real cases where people use indoor TVs outdoors without immediate failure. But they share specific conditions:

One-time or occasional use. Bringing a TV outside for a party or a few weekend sessions is fundamentally different from a permanent installation. Short-term exposure with careful handling — bring it inside after use, keep it covered between sessions — carries much lower risk than leaving it mounted for months.

Fully enclosed, climate-controlled spaces. A sunroom with HVAC, a garage with a dehumidifier, or an indoor-adjacent space where temperature and humidity are actively managed is closer to indoor conditions than outdoor. If ambient humidity and temperature stay within normal indoor ranges, the risk decreases substantially.

Covered porch in a dry climate with careful setup. A north-facing covered porch in Phoenix or Las Vegas — low humidity, no direct sun, no rain exposure — is a genuinely lower-risk environment than the same setup in Houston or Miami. Some people run indoor TVs in these conditions for a year or more. The risk is still present; it's just slower to materialize.

The Scenarios Where It Reliably Fails

  • Humid climates (Southeast, Gulf Coast, Pacific Northwest). High ambient humidity is the primary accelerant for indoor TV failure outdoors. Condensation forms more frequently, dries more slowly, and creates ideal conditions for corrosion.
  • Any direct rain exposure. Even occasional sideways rain reaching the screen or back panel will cause damage. "Under a roof" does not mean protected from rain.
  • Direct sun exposure. Beyond the brightness issue (an indoor TV will be nearly invisible in direct sun), UV and heat will degrade the unit quickly. Months, not years.
  • Year-round permanent installation. Even in favorable conditions, temperature cycling — hot summers and cold winters — stresses seals, adhesives, and components not built for that range. Most indoor TVs are rated for 50–90°F operating temperature and 32°F minimum storage.

The TV Enclosure Option: A Third Path

There's a middle-ground option that many guides skip: a weatherproof TV enclosure that houses a regular indoor TV. These are sealed, vented boxes rated for outdoor exposure that you mount an existing TV inside.

The cost reality, based on 2026 pricing:

Option Upfront cost (55") Notes
Indoor TV only (no protection) $300–$600 Short lifespan outdoors; no warranty coverage for outdoor damage
Indoor TV + weatherproof enclosure $900–$2,000+ Enclosures for 55" run $600–$1,200; adds bulk and requires ventilation management
Dedicated outdoor TV (entry-level, full shade) $1,199–$1,599 Certified IP rating, outdoor warranty, built-in brightness
Dedicated outdoor TV (partial/full sun) $1,599–$2,399 1,500–2,000 nits; usable in direct sun

The enclosure path makes sense in specific situations: you already own a large, high-quality indoor TV you want to repurpose, or you have an unusual size requirement that the outdoor TV market doesn't serve. But for most buyers starting from scratch, the cost math is closer than it first appears — and the enclosure adds significant bulk and installation complexity.

The Brightness Problem: Separate From Durability

Even setting aside durability entirely, there's a practical visibility issue: indoor TVs are dim by outdoor standards.

A typical indoor TV peaks at 400–600 nits. In full shade outdoors, that's workable for evening viewing but noticeably dim during the day. In partial sun, the image washes out significantly. In any direct sunlight, the screen is effectively unwatchable.

This means the use case for an indoor TV outside is already constrained to: evening or nighttime viewing, in a shaded location, in favorable weather. If those conditions describe your setup, an indoor TV might survive reasonably well — but you're also giving up afternoon and daytime viewing entirely.

Who This Makes Sense For (And Who It Doesn't)

Using an indoor TV outside can be reasonable if:

  • It's for a one-time event or occasional seasonal use — and the TV comes back inside afterward
  • Your space is a fully enclosed, climate-controlled room (sunroom, heated garage) that happens to have outdoor access
  • You're in a dry climate with a genuinely protected north-facing covered porch and primarily watch in the evening
  • You're willing to replace the TV every 1–2 years and the math works out cheaper than a dedicated outdoor TV for your use case

It's the wrong call if:

  • You want to watch during daylight hours — the brightness won't be adequate
  • You're in a humid climate (Southeast US, Pacific Northwest, coastal areas)
  • You want to leave the TV mounted year-round without bringing it in
  • Your space gets any direct sun or rain exposure
  • You're planning a permanent installation and don't want to deal with replacement in 12–18 months

FAQ

Will my indoor TV void the warranty if I use it outside?
Almost certainly yes. Most manufacturer warranties explicitly exclude damage from environmental exposure. If your TV fails due to humidity or heat damage from outdoor use, a warranty claim will likely be denied. Check your specific warranty terms, but don't plan on coverage for outdoor use of an indoor product.

What if I keep my indoor TV under a roof — is it safe?
A roof protects against direct rain from above but not against wind-driven moisture, humidity, condensation, insects, or dust. Whether it's "safe" depends on your climate, the specific installation, and how you define safe. In low-humidity climates with careful setup, it can last. In humid climates, the roof alone is insufficient protection.

Can I use a TV cover to protect an indoor TV outside?
A cover helps when the TV isn't in use — keeping rain, dew, and debris off the screen between sessions. It doesn't address the core problem of humidity cycling in and out of an unsealed housing while the TV is in use, or condensation forming inside overnight in humid climates. A cover is a partial measure, not a solution.

How long will an indoor TV last outside?
This varies significantly by climate and setup. In dry climates with a well-covered, shaded installation: potentially 1–3 years. In humid climates or any exposure to rain or direct sun: weeks to months. The most honest answer is that it's unpredictable — which is the core problem with relying on an indoor TV for an outdoor install you care about.
